Patrick's review of Kitchen Confidential: Adventures in the Culinary Underbelly
Kitchen Confidential: Adventures in the Culinary Underbelly by Anthony Bourdain
This book is an excellent example of why I'm not in the restaurant business, nor do I ever want to be. But I do really admire this alcohol loving, Ramones / Misfits listening chef who makes it all sound so disgusting and oddly romantic at the same time. Anthony Bourdain is a regular in my household, his show "No Reservations" on the Travel Channel is what opened my eyes to his books and his east coast snark which I have a soft place in my heart for. Foodie or not, I think this book can hold it's own.
